Proto-Koreanic is the reconstructed ancestor of the Koreanic family — Korean and its historical stages, with Jeju as a divergent variety. It is placed on the Korean peninsula from roughly the 1st century BCE to the 7th century CE (the emergence of Old Korean). Koreanic has a shallow attested depth, so the reconstruction stays close to Old and Middle Korean.
